电子产业一站式赋能平台

PCB联盟网

搜索
查看: 1146|回复: 0
收起左侧

深入了解高通骁龙X Elite:Oryon CPU架构详解

[复制链接]

1075

主题

1075

帖子

1万

积分

论坛法老

Rank: 6Rank: 6

积分
11406
发表于 2024-10-14 08:00:00 | 显示全部楼层 |阅读模式
引言
; a: ~/ J& P$ ^2 K为帮助读者了解最新的移动计算技术,本文将探讨高通骁龙X Elite系统芯片(SoC)及其核心——Oryon CPU[1]。我们将详细分析Oryon CPU的架构特点和性能指标,为读者提供技术洞察。
" {, B' H7 Z  g. E6 l
% D- e! d; e, W0 N6 C9 ^骁龙X Elite的核心:Oryon CPU
  I0 |: o* X4 O- H骁龙X Elite SoC的核心是高通自主设计的Oryon CPU。这款处理器凝聚了多年的研发成果,旨在为各种计算任务提供卓越的性能和效率。! u4 K$ t6 K- ?% F" I
" n2 p6 a0 @# x, l; e
CPU微架构2 U9 o  r- ^( m; d- X3 f
Oryon CPU的微架构设计平衡了高性能和能效。虽然具体架构细节属于专有信息,但我们可以根据提供的资料推断几个关键特性:
  • 先进指令集:Oryon CPU很可能支持广泛的现代指令集,能够高效执行复杂任务。
  • 复杂分支预测:为减少流水线停顿并提高整体性能,CPU采用了先进的分支预测技术。
  • 乱序执行:此特性允许CPU通过最高效的顺序处理指令来优化执行,而非严格按顺序执行。
  • 宽执行单元:CPU可能配备多个宽执行单元,以处理并行指令。
  • 大寄存器文件:大容量寄存器文件有助于减少内存访问延迟,提升整体性能。- w, n: K, _2 K
    [/ol], g& j1 g  V4 c, o* F  N
    * J! A- x) t0 r
    缓存层次结构
    - P5 l0 B+ q: V: o3 N缓存系统对Oryon CPU的性能起着关键作用。让我们来看看缓存结构:! n) a& w% L/ }# `, H

    lgbqmp3gwmc6403233440.png

    lgbqmp3gwmc6403233440.png

    8 F% O( X5 v+ [- ?$ S% N9 k图1展示了Oryon CPU的缓存层次结构,详细说明了L1和L2缓存的大小和配置。
    # T! B' }7 ^% c; g( v* [1 P3 I8 B0 b3 H1 d1 T9 m5 I
    L1缓存:
    9 e4 A& W; b) \
  • 指令缓存:64KB,4路组相联
  • 数据缓存:64KB,4路组相联
  • TLB(转译后备缓冲器):2K条目1 ~7 p) ?6 ?4 N; I( ^

    6 [" Y  J& ?9 S) s, Z# f/ I9 \L2缓存:7 M; S2 P4 H5 |$ r
  • 统一缓存:2MB,16路组相联
  • TLB:8K条目
    0 f) |. W, q6 M* ^

    - G8 \/ l; b5 l8 L4 S6 U9 _! y这种多级缓存系统旨在减少内存访问延迟,提高整体系统性能。L1缓存分为独立的指令和数据缓存,为频繁使用的数据和指令提供快速访问。更大的L2缓存作为指令和数据的统一存储库,进一步减少对较慢主内存的访问需求。
    5 s% X1 F. B1 f4 N
    3 {$ U1 T5 S( _" H/ W性能基准测试
    * l: N# ~! x9 {! l: |$ d0 D为了解Oryon CPU的实际性能,让我们看看一些基准测试结果:
    # h  I6 @: z2 R. S

    zgux5xbagsw6403233540.png

    zgux5xbagsw6403233540.png
    ) L7 u; ~# y; M1 x
    图2展示了Oryon CPU在Windows、Windows Subsystem for Linux (WSL)和原生Linux环境中的Geekbench 6.3.0基准测试分数。
    7 G1 z! J  N, |  M' w8 i! `; T, l+ g
    Geekbench 6.3.0结果:
    ) t! g1 g+ [! ~, g! E1. Windows:% d7 Y. f. M/ q3 Q3 W
  • 单核分数:2868
  • 整数分数:2840
  • 浮点分数:2920+ o) N" R1 F! F3 N6 ^6 Y
    + R7 r( \" P7 K8 w
    2. Windows Subsystem for Linux (WSL):/ w- G( E' J  c
  • 单核分数:2953
  • 整数分数:2892
  • 浮点分数:3070
    % I* Z- v4 p% E" B& n7 J) N2 g

    ) E$ g/ q6 v- ]- J% S; z  i) k" W, p! Z3. 原生Linux:. R8 R5 H: n# ^; V# o. _
  • 单核分数:3169
  • 整数分数:3091
  • 浮点分数:3320" R2 n4 w7 n% d8 I: G- X7 F

    5 b  R% U* |1 b; I1 f这些分数展示了Oryon CPU在不同操作系统中的强劲性能。值得注意的是,CPU在Linux环境中表现更佳,在原生Linux中获得最高分数。9 i5 {! m) o- T* b" z: G
    ' P; C9 ~: Z( l" e& G5 q

    r2kqjz3012p6403233640.png

    r2kqjz3012p6403233640.png

    8 l* H/ z. ~1 W  x5 H0 m( w图3呈现了Oryon CPU在WSL和原生Linux环境中的SPEC CPU2017基准测试分数,展示了在各种计算任务中的性能。9 x7 C8 L: m. C3 `* c+ F
    ' c6 B- }* `, s! O2 I9 Z7 V$ T
    SPEC CPU2017结果:4 ~1 f1 |. |4 ~% _5 L
    1. Windows Subsystem for Linux (WSL):' D5 {$ q# n4 {! S
  • IntRate:9.70
  • FPRate:16.66
    . G5 n: E% c! ]
    " Q5 I0 j: ~; X
    2. 原生Linux:9 _7 O: E+ h* n  C' |7 _
  • IntRate:10.64
  • FPRate:17.772 J) \& S( c0 Z* {) M4 d
    3 T3 P! T* u( k( B, K. n
    SPEC CPU2017基准测试结果进一步展示了Oryon CPU在整数和浮点运算方面的能力。原生Linux中的更高分数再次表明在此环境中性能得到了优化。
    + g3 V! g2 U* y, K! I, ]( a& X
    内存子系统性能
    ' S  h0 p+ x, e# b9 B* Q) Q& E  P. ?Oryon CPU的内存子系统设计追求高带宽和低延迟,对整体系统性能至为重要。
    ; G' K- b" {' S6 t

    pg4rgpa055d6403233741.png

    pg4rgpa055d6403233741.png

    : _! m3 p+ D2 Q3 M8 j图4展示了Oryon CPU在不同块大小和访问模式下的内存延迟特性。5 y4 @! N6 g  E- }/ t5 p
    , l6 u: d* N2 [7 G" u5 V& K7 Z% [+ e0 b
    该图展示了CPU在各种访问模式和块大小下的内存延迟性能。不同线条代表不同的内存访问场景,如随机访问、页面对齐访问和线性访问。这些数据有助于理解CPU在不同内存访问模式下的表现,对软件性能优化非常重要。+ z# h- s1 j/ k2 t7 \- C* S
    + J( |7 d) m; D7 ]4 i- P' b- {

    yryjc1q2ifs6403233841.png

    yryjc1q2ifs6403233841.png
    % Q5 X+ `' p; i( P6 w
    图5展示了Oryon CPU在不同测试深度和操作下的内存带宽性能。
    1 C5 X' H7 ~0 o# |) ~& `% c# Q4 @( }. M+ T9 b  Q) |! l
    带宽图显示了CPU在不同测试深度(以KB为单位)下的性能(以GB/s为单位)。图中展示了向量加载(v128Load)和向量存储(v128StoreC)操作的带宽。图表显示,即使测试深度增加,CPU仍能保持高带宽,表明内存子系统设计高效。) F" P& ?" ]  ?$ R
    : O' t+ }' W0 x/ A3 w
    高通Oryon CPU技术
    / M8 |1 x! C3 pOryon CPU代表了高通CPU设计理念的重大进步。该技术的一些关键方面包括:
  • 定制设计:Oryon CPU是一款定制设计的核心,专为满足高通目标市场的特定需求而打造。
  • 性能聚焦:在保持能效的同时,Oryon CPU着重提供各种应用的高性能。
  • 可扩展性:该架构可能设计为可扩展,允许在从手机到笔记本电脑,甚至可能到服务器的各种设备中实施。
  • 先进制程:CPU使用尖端半导体制程技术制造,实现更高性能和更好的能效。! m/ r/ Q: E! g4 y* y( }
    [/ol]0 ?4 j0 j1 u8 s# u1 Q" [+ Z" d5 `
    特定领域设计定制
    5 P' u3 Y: j. K$ t高通可能在Oryon CPU设计中实施了针对特定领域的优化:
  • 移动优化:增强移动设备的电池寿命和热管理功能。
  • 笔记本电脑增强:优化笔记本电脑形态的持续高性能。
  • 服务器能力:可能包含支持服务器级操作的功能,如增强的虚拟化支持或针对数据中心工作负载的专用指令。
    8 S: |/ k: o, V3 Z7 n" Z[/ol]
    - H0 s; O" a5 ?0 L结论7 c: j- c9 X. e' @
    高通骁龙X Elite及其Oryon CPU代表了移动和边缘计算技术的重大进步。凭借先进的微架构、复杂的缓存系统和令人印象深刻的基准性能,Oryon CPU展示了高通在推动移动计算可能性方面的承诺。
    : M1 C3 U, x) {# @  r' V3 u) l% w: j! a9 u; }- n
    基准测试结果显示,该CPU在不同操作环境中都表现出强劲性能,尤其在基于Linux的系统中表现突出。这表明Oryon CPU有望在各种计算领域竞争,从移动设备到笔记本电脑,甚至可能涉足服务器环境。
    ( d* X& Q- }+ R$ }
    0 c: x" J# A. Q: x, Z2 D内存子系统的低延迟和高带宽特性进一步提升了CPU的整体性能,确保数据密集型应用能够流畅高效地运行。6 q' L: Z, m/ J5 ^/ t

    ; e$ n' A+ [$ d/ o7 v: N随着软件开发人员和硬件工程师继续探索骁龙X Elite及其Oryon CPU的能力,有望看到充分利用这一强大平台的新型创新应用。像Oryon CPU这样的技术正在引领移动和边缘计算的未来发展。) J" C$ X. b5 d  }4 N; V2 |8 \

    ; _3 O0 W) g# J+ [6 X3 B4 Q参考文献
    6 s$ j: X$ n0 F5 s+ k% M[1] G. Williams, "Snapdragon X65 5G Modem Qualcomm FastConnect 7800 Wi-Fi & Bluetooth Qualcomm Oryon CPUs Powering the SoC," Qualcomm Technologies, Inc., Jun. 2024.
    $ A5 N2 W$ D  ?, {! |, `5 `8 m
    2 q( J! q7 r8 z7 H) m- END -# ~6 V1 E, G/ l  f

    ' d, ~, J6 w7 v4 g1 i6 G6 V软件申请我们欢迎化合物/硅基光电子芯片的研究人员和工程师申请体验免费版PIC Studio软件。无论是研究还是商业应用,PIC Studio都可提升您的工作效能。& R* n: g; @0 h& u& F! \" z# e$ U
    点击左下角"阅读原文"马上申请
    ( a; R* U( F+ U! p1 W, S, v3 j/ H( i  Q& z5 l6 E
    欢迎转载" u+ x, t, ?) S4 O5 b& x6 Z

    9 p7 E$ F% `7 c4 w8 n转载请注明出处,请勿修改内容和删除作者信息!
    ( ?2 V2 m. P3 G# K2 l& l. m3 J$ d+ F( v$ H1 e
    * S; R  e- _8 |3 M7 W) r
    + c+ @/ K4 i- m: ^: Z

    eggb2vmvekr6403233941.gif

    eggb2vmvekr6403233941.gif
    / {6 ^4 k4 i9 ^1 Q- z
    5 h6 r: \2 s/ e3 |. D- v1 h
    关注我们+ C) @+ {. @: n9 o) y6 p- Y* [  ]  [

    " H$ m  M3 `/ ]
    , X* ]7 `7 d+ X$ W( ]5 ?% H

    30ihafpajgh6403234041.png

    30ihafpajgh6403234041.png
    5 q3 O8 z! d# }6 e! c# S

    * D- k0 H# M1 O3 B8 ~

    fuvtznfagr46403234141.png

    fuvtznfagr46403234141.png
    3 O/ O9 v1 n7 t  z. N) c
    5 d1 g5 \: f. Q8 x/ x* F

    045hohcnbwf6403234241.png

    045hohcnbwf6403234241.png

    ; a5 d" e' j$ B) j+ _* m
                          " w; D- i2 G5 d9 `* ~: I/ C5 z
    , W& z, F& t- l" D
    4 R3 W( g) e% _! @4 ]4 O. Q

    2 t. p! H" w  d# @关于我们:9 Z3 B( N, _* [' _  v
    深圳逍遥科技有限公司(Latitude Design Automation Inc.)是一家专注于半导体芯片设计自动化(EDA)的高科技软件公司。我们自主开发特色工艺芯片设计和仿真软件,提供成熟的设计解决方案如PIC Studio、MEMS Studio和Meta Studio,分别针对光电芯片、微机电系统、超透镜的设计与仿真。我们提供特色工艺的半导体芯片集成电路版图、IP和PDK工程服务,广泛服务于光通讯、光计算、光量子通信和微纳光子器件领域的头部客户。逍遥科技与国内外晶圆代工厂及硅光/MEMS中试线合作,推动特色工艺半导体产业链发展,致力于为客户提供前沿技术与服务。" l5 E, o$ R* {

    6 u# Y' S. e; x# r" Chttp://www.latitudeda.com/
    ! F6 ?- r& c) d(点击上方名片关注我们,发现更多精彩内容)
  • 回复

    使用道具 举报

    发表回复

    您需要登录后才可以回帖 登录 | 立即注册

    本版积分规则


    联系客服 关注微信 下载APP 返回顶部 返回列表